A method to convert the hydroacoustic survey estimates of small pelagic biomass from a March/April 2025 survey to equivalent biomasses that might have been surveyed in November 2024, for use in 2025 fisheries management advice

<p dir="ltr">A hydroacoustic survey of the small pelagic biomass off the South African coastline was conducted in March/April 2025 in lieu of the cancelled November/December 2024 survey. This document considers the timeseries of historical ratios of November : April biomasses corresponding to these surveys from the most recent full stock assessments. Based on these assessments, the March/April 2025 survey estimates of biomass for anchovy, sardine west of Cape Agulhas, sardine east of Cape Agulhas and round herring could be multiplied by factors of 0.98, 0.92, 1.12 and 0.91 respectively to adjust the biomass to correspond to late 2024 for use in fisheries management advice for 2025. However, lower ratios should additionally be considered given the variability in these ratios.</p>
